Creekview High School serves 1,926 learners in grades 9-12.
Creekview High School placed in the upper 30% of all schools in Texas for cumulative test scores (math proficiency is upper 30%, and reading proficiency is upper 30%) for the 2020-21 school year.
The percentage of learners achieving proficiency in math is 59% (which is higher than the Texas state average of 49%) for the 2020-21 school year. The percentage of learners ach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 53% (which is higher than the Texas state average of 45%) for the 2020-21 school year.
The learner:teacher ratio of 16:1 is higher than the Texas state average of 15:1.
Minority enrollment is 78% of the learner body (majority Latino), which is higher than the Texas state average of 72% (majority Latino).
School Overview: Creekview High School’s learner population of 1,926 learners has stayed flat over five school years.
The teacher population of 124 teachers has stayed flat over five school years.
School Comparison: Creekview High School is ranked within the upper 30% of all 7,999 schools in Texas (based off of combined math and reading proficiency testing data) for the 2020-21 school year.
The equity score of Creekview High School is 0.69, which is more than the equity score at state average of 0.64. The school’s equity has stayed flat over five school years.
